GLUTEN FREE MACARONI AND CHEESE

Even though you've got dietary restrictions, that doesn't mean that yummy comfort food is off the menu!

Provided by IrishEyes.NYC

Categories     Cheese

Time 1h15m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7



Gluten Free Macaroni and Cheese image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375° F and grease 13 x 9 casserole dish.
  • Cook macaroni according to package directions BUT reduce cooking time so the pasta is still quite a bit firm.
  • Drain macaroni and set aside.
  • Melt butter in medium saucepan.
  • Stir in seasoned salt and pepper; remove from heat and set aside.
  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k corn starch into milk until smooth.
  • Stir milk into butter mixture and whisk until well-blended.
  • Stirring constantly, cook over medium heat until thickened (about 5 minutes or so) and remove from heat.
  • Stir three cups of shredded cheese into sauce until melted; reserve one cup of cheese for topping.
  • Combine cheese mixture with macaroni and spoon into prepared pan.
  • Top with crunchy topping (recipe below) and reserved shredded cheese.
  • Bake uncovered for 25-30 minutes or until crunchy topping is nice and toasty.
  • CRUNCHY TOPPING: Pulse in a food processor until it becomes coarse crumbs: 2 slices toasted gluten-free bread; 1 tsp butter, softened; 1/2 teaspoons paprika.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 611.9, Fat 30.7, SaturatedFat 18.9, Cholesterol 83.8, Sodium 711.1, Carbohydrate 60.5, Fiber 2, Sugar 1.6, Protein 23.1

8 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on seasoning salt
3/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
4 cups milk
1/3 cup cornstarch
4 cups shredded cheese, divided
16 ounces gluten-free elbow macaroni

EASY GLUTEN-FREE MACARONI AND CHEESE

Cheesy gluten-free deliciousness that is super easy to make. Kid-approved!

Provided by Rick Kleinhans (kokodiablo)

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Pasta     Macaroni and Cheese Recipes     Baked Macaroni and Cheese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 10



Easy Gluten-Free Macaroni and Cheese image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ook elbow macaroni in the boiling water, stirring occasionally until cooked through but firm to the bite, 8 minutes. Drain.
  • Melt 1/4 cup but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Stir salt and mustard powder into melted butter and remove saucepan from heat.
  • Whisk milk and cornstarch together in a bowl until smooth; stir into butter mixture until well blended. Return saucepan to stove; cook milk mixture, stirring constantly, over medium heat until sauce is thickened, about 5 minutes. Remove saucepan from heat.
  • Stir 3 cups Cheddar cheese into sauce until heat from sauce melts cheese. Add pasta to cheese sauce and stir well; pour into the prepared baking dish.
  • Combine remaining 1 cup Cheddar cheese, gluten-free bread crumbs, 1 teaspoon butter, and paprika in a bowl; sprinkle over pasta mixture.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until top is crunchy, about 30 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 521.3 calories, Carbohydrate 42.6 g, Cholesterol 85.7 mg, Fat 29.8 g, Fiber 1.4 g, Protein 21 g, SaturatedFat 17.5 g, Sodium 809.1 mg, Sugar 6.2 g

10 ounces gluten-free elbow pasta
¼ cup butter
1 ¼ teaspoons salt
¾ teaspoon mustard powder
4 cups milk
¼ cup cornstarch
4 cups shredded Cheddar cheese, divided
2 gluten-free bread slices, toasted and broken into crumbs
1 teaspoon butter, softened
½ teaspoon paprika

GLUTEN-FREE MACARONI AND CHEESE

]It seems sometimes there are only two choices with macaroni and cheese: Make it from scratch with a roux and slow-simmered cheese sauce, or tear open a box and make it in minutes. It turns out you don't have to choose between quality and convenience. This quick method uses goat cheese, aged white Cheddar and gluten-free pasta. Throw in some dark lacinato kale and you have a complete meal in about 25 minutes.

Provided by Shauna Ahern

Time 25m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5



Gluten-Free Macaroni and Cheese image

Steps:

  • Cook the macaroni. Set a large pot of salted water over high heat. (Add enough salt to the water to make it taste like the ocean.) Bring the water to a boil. Add the macaroni. Stir for at least 1 minute to make sure the pieces do not stick together. Set the timer for 8 minutes.
  • Set up the sauce. While the pasta is boiling, put the goat cheese, Cheddar and kale in the bottom of a large, wide bowl.
  • Finish the dish. When the macaroni is tender but still has a bite (al dente), remove it from the pot with a Chinese spider or slotted spoon. Put it on top of the cheese and kale. Pour in about 1/3 to 1/2 cup of the water the macaroni cooked in. Let everything sit for 5 minutes. Stir the mixture until the macaroni is coated in a creamy sauce, with kale dotted through it.

Salt
16 ounces (2 boxes) dried gluten-free elbow macaroni
4 ounces soft goat cheese (chevre), crumbled
4 ounces aged white Cheddar, grated
1 large bunch lacinato kale, stems removed, leaves cut into ribbons

GLUTEN-FREE MAC AND CHEESE

With our Gluten-Free Mac and Cheese everyone can enjoy a forkful of warm, comforting mac and cheese, complete with a crunchy topping for dinner.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Pasta and Grains

Number Of Ingredients 11



Gluten-Free Mac and Cheese image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Butter six 8-ounce ramekins or a 2-quart baking dish. Microwave 1 tablespoon butter until melted, then toss with cereal and Parmesan.
  • In a medium saucepan, melt 2 tablespoons butter over medium. Add onion and cook until softened, 4 minutes. Sprinkle with potato starch and cook 1 minute. Slowly whisk in milk and cook, whisking constantly, until thickened, about 3 minutes. Remove from heat and stir in cheddar and mustard until smooth; season with salt and pepper. Add pasta and stir to coat; transfer to ramekins or baking dish. Sprinkle with cereal mixture and bake until sauce is bubbling and topping is golden, 15 to 20 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 581 g, Fat 29 g, Fiber 2 g, Protein 23 g, SaturatedFat 18 g

3 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us more for dish
1/2 cup gluten-free crisp puffed-rice cereal, slightly crushed
1 ounce Parmesan, grated (1/4 cup)
1 small yellow onion, diced small
2 tablespoons potato starch
2 cups whole milk, warmed
3/4 pound cheddar, shredded (3 cups)
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
3/4 pound gluten-free penne, cooked until al dente and drained
unsalted butter
Coarse salt and ground pepper
